Hello Nomad friends.  Happy Easter.  Hope you have chocolate eggs.  I settled for real ones from my own hens, but such pretty colours!!!   Despite having visitors I am carving out a few hours for myself for crafting.  Starting with another wedding card today.  This one is a bit more blingy and dramatic using a beautiful dark paper with spring flowers from Lexi Design Home Sweet Home.  

I used Tonic pink glitter card and the bridal couple are a Marianne Designs die.
